Season and Care of Jacob's Ladder and Inkberry
Season and care of Jacob's Ladder and Inkberry is important to know. While considering everything about Jacob's Ladder and Inkberry Care, growing season is an essential factor. Jacob's Ladder season is Spring, Summer and Fall and Inkberry season is Spring, Summer and Fall. The type of soil for Jacob's Ladder is Clay, Loam, Sand and for Inkberry is Clay, Loam, Sand while the PH of soil for Jacob's Ladder is Acidic, Neutral, Alkaline and for Inkberry is Acidic, Neutral.
Jacob's Ladder and Inkberry Physical Information
Jacob's Ladder and Inkberry physical information is very important for comparison. Jacob's Ladder height is 20.30 cm and width 27.90 cm whereas Inkberry height is 120.00 cm and width 180.00 cm. The color specification of Jacob's Ladder and Inkberry are as follows:
Jacob's Ladder flower color: Blue and Lavender
Jacob's Ladder leaf color: Green and Purple
Inkberry flower color: White
- Inkberry leaf color: Green and Dark Green
Care of Jacob's Ladder and Inkberry
Care of Jacob's Ladder and Inkberry include pruning, fertilizers, watering etc. Jacob's Ladder pruning is done Remove damaged leaves, Remove dead branches and Remove dead leaves and Inkberry pruning is done No pruning needed in the early stages, Prune if you want to improve plant shape, Remove damaged leaves, Remove dead branches, Remove dead leaves and Shape and thin as needed. In summer Jacob's Ladder needs Lots of watering and in winter, it needs Average Water. Whereas, in summer Inkberry needs Lots of watering and in winter, it needs Average Water.
